When to round up
Round up for setup messages, file repair, support removal, sanding, packaging, rush orders, payment fees, and repeat-customer discounts you choose to absorb.

Worked example
Example inputs: Material cost: $2.75; Electricity cost: $0.35; Hands-on labor: 12 minutes; Labor rate: $18 /hour; Machine time: 5 hours; Machine rate: $0.75 /hour; Failure risk buffer: 10 %; Margin markup: 30 %. With those values, the calculator returns $14.94 quote estimate. A quote around $14.94 covers material, electricity, labor, machine time, failure risk, and margin.

Common planning mistakes
Using guessed material instead of slicer output, ignoring support or purge waste, underpricing labor, forgetting failed prints, and treating one tuned profile as reliable for every material.
